Community Highlights: Meet David Warner of David Warner Photography LLC

Today we’d like to introduce you to David Warner.

Hi David, can you start by introducing yourself? We’d love to learn more about how you got to where you are today?
The Early Days: Hustle and Vinyl
Fifty years ago, it all began with a passion for music. As a college student, I started out as a mobile DJ, hauling massive speakers and heavy crates of vinyl records to birthdays, Sweet Sixteens, and Bar Mitzvahs. There were no cell phones or GPS—just pure hustle and a love for making people dance.

Building an Entertainment Empire
As technology evolved from cassettes to CDs to laptops, so did my business. I partnered with a talented magician, and as my family grew, we officially formed Events Plus Entertainment. We expanded far beyond music, growing into a massive operation. We brought Las Vegas-style casino nights to charities, set up full carnivals for company picnics, and hosted live, interactive TV-style game shows.

Finding a New Lens on Life
While running these massive events, I found myself drawn to capturing the smiles and pure joy of the crowds we were entertaining. What started as a photography “side hustle” began to steadily grow alongside the entertainment company.

A Timely Pivot
In early 2020, in a stroke of incredibly good timing, I sold my share of the entertainment business just before the pandemic changed the world. This allowed me to pivot entirely to my true calling: photography. During those early pandemic years, I shifted to documenting beautiful, intimate park weddings and small backyard gatherings.

Where I Am Today
For the past 11 years, my camera has been my constant companion. Today, I am a full-time photographer capturing the full spectrum of life’s milestones—from professional headshots and corporate galas to weddings, family portraits, and holiday events. From a college kid hauling records to a seasoned photographer, the tools have changed, but my mission remains the exact same: to create, connect, and capture memories that last a lifetime.
